Infectious Disease Expert Dr. Edsel Salavana said Tuesday, July 5, dengue cases should be “closely monitored” as dengue cases in the country rose by 58%.
A total of 51,622 dengue cases were recorded from January 1 to June 18, 58% higher compared to the reported cases during the same period in 2021, the Department of Health (DOH) reported Monday, July 4.
